How they compare
Solomon Islands currently reports 0.5665 UIS estimate against 0.563 UIS estimate in Saint Kitts and Nevis, a difference of 0.0035 UIS estimate.
The two have swapped places 4 times across 12 shared years of data; in 2012 it was Solomon Islands ahead.
Solomon Islands ranks 172nd and Saint Kitts and Nevis ranks 173rd of 208 countries.
Solomon Islands has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.
